How they compare
Congo currently reports 105.21 USD/m3 against 90.59 USD/m3 in United Arab Emirates, a difference of 14.62 USD/m3.
That makes Congo's figure about 1.2 times United Arab Emirates's.
Across all 24 years both countries report, Congo has been ahead every year.
Congo ranks 24th and United Arab Emirates ranks 27th of 155 countries.
Congo has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Congo | United Arab Emirates |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 106.74 USD/m3 | 64.45 USD/m3 | 42.3 USD/m3 | Congo |
| 2010s | 111.34 USD/m3 | 73.4 USD/m3 | 37.94 USD/m3 | Congo |
| 2020s | 102.88 USD/m3 | 82.98 USD/m3 | 19.9 USD/m3 | Congo |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
